  1. Metabolic Machinery Optimization
    Your brain is the most metabolically expensive organ in your body. Its performance is inextricably linked to your metabolic health. Poor glucose control and insulin resistance create a state of systemic inflammation and reduce the brain’s access to clean energy. The initial step is to re-engineer your metabolic machinery through precise nutritional protocols and physical activity. This establishes the stable energetic foundation required for all higher-level cognitive processes.
  2. Endocrine System Recalibration
    Hormones are the master signaling molecules of the body, and their decline directly impacts brain function. Sex hormones like testosterone and estrogen have profound neuroprotective effects and modulate neurotransmitter systems that govern mood, focus, and memory. A decline in these hormones can correlate with increased cognitive static. Recalibration through hormone replacement therapy (HRT) is a direct intervention to restore these critical signaling molecules to optimal physiological levels, effectively upgrading the brain’s operating system.
  3. Peptide-Based Cellular Instruction
    Peptides are small protein chains that act as highly specific cellular messengers. They provide a new layer of precision in biological optimization. Certain peptides can cross the blood-brain barrier to deliver targeted instructions that support neuronal health, promote the growth of new neurons (neurogenesis), and reduce inflammation. This is akin to deploying specialized software patches to improve the function of your neural hardware, enhancing synaptic communication and protecting against cellular stress.
